Apologies - I've answered my own question: It would appear that my laptop
(which I don't use very much) was not set up correctly either. When setting
up the email account, I needed to include the full email address under user
name, even though as you tab through the process Outlook automatically cuts
off the domain name part of the email address. I just had to put it back
again and everything was ok.
"Gillian" wrote:
I have just purchased a new PC running Windows Vista. I have installed.
Outlook 2007 and have set up and successfully tested my Yahoo email account.
I am trying to set up my business account but it fails on test.
I have the account set up already on my Vista laptop, also running Outlook
2007, and have copied the settings exactly.
I have also checked that the password is correct by logging onto the Horde
Webmail for this account - and that works, too.
Both laptop and PC are running Norton Antivirus and have the same DEP
settings.
I don't know Vista well enough to think of any other ideas. Help!
